PKG files are a type of file used by the PlayStation console family to distribute and install games and other content. These files contain the game's data, including its code, assets, and other necessary files, which are extracted and installed on the console during the installation process. PKG files are typically used for digital distributions, such as those found on the PlayStation Store, but they can also be created and used for custom content.
